The primary role of mechanical engineers in industry is to design, develop, and test mechanical devices and systems. They work on a wide range of products, from small components to large industrial machines. Mechanical engineers use their knowledge of physics, mathematics, and materials science to design and analyze products. They also use computer-aided design (CAD) software to create and modify designs.

In summary, the roles and responsibilities of mechanical engineers in industry include:

  • Designing and developing mechanical devices and systems
  • Testing and evaluating mechanical products and systems
  • Identifying and solving problems related to mechanical systems
  • Ensuring that products meet the required standards and regulations
  • Collaborating with other professionals, such as electrical engineers and industrial designers

Design and Development

As a mechanical engineer, one of the primary responsibilities is to design and develop mechanical devices and systems. This involves creating detailed designs and specifications, selecting materials, and determining the best manufacturing processes. It also involves conducting feasibility studies and cost analysis to ensure that the product is viable and cost-effective.

Testing and Evaluation

Mechanical engineers also play a crucial role in testing and evaluating mechanical products and systems. This involves conducting tests to ensure that the product meets the required standards and regulations. Mechanical engineers also evaluate the performance of the product and identify any problems or issues.

Problem Solving

Another critical responsibility of mechanical engineers is to identify and solve problems related to mechanical systems. This involves analyzing data, identifying the root cause of the problem, and developing solutions to fix the issue. Mechanical engineers need to have strong analytical and problem-solving skills to deal with these challenges.
